TORONTO, Dec. 05,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Emerita Resources Corp. (TSX-V: EMO; OTCQB: EMOTF; FSE: LLJA) (the “Company” or “Emerita”) continues to intersect significant mineralization at its ongoing drilling campaign at El Cura. El Cura is part of Emerita’s wholly owned Iberian Belt West project (“IBW” or the “Project”; Figure 1) and is one of three identified Volcanogenic Massive Sulphide (VMS) deposits on the Project: La Romanera, El Cura and La Infanta.

Drill results to date are demonstrating that the El Cura deposit is a more copper-gold-silver rich system and lower in zinc and lead than either La Romanera or La Infanta deposits. There is a thicker volume of high grade copper-gold mineralization emerging within El Cura deposit, delineated by 5 holes to date EC013, 014, 020, 022 and 028 (Figure 3). This zone remains open for expansion at depth and down-plunge as does the deposit. Results contained in this news release are from El Cura deposit, and include:

  • Drillhole EC028 intersected 13.15m grading 1.1% copper, 1.1% lead, 3.3% zinc, 54.63 g/t silver and 2.71 g/t gold including 4m grading 1.7% copper, 0.5% lead, 2.1% zinc, 60.25 g/t silver and 3.91 g/t gold

  • Drillhole EC022 intersected 6.3m grading 0.7% copper, 0.2% lead, 0.1% zinc, 29.21 g/t silver and1.99 g/t gold, including 1.5m grading 1.3% copper, 0.2% lead, 0.2% zinc, 42.30 g/t silver and 3.30 g/t gold

  • Drillhole EC021 intersected 1.7m grading 0.9% copper, 2.1% lead, 4.0% zinc, 68.35 g/t silver and 2.01 g/t gold

  • Drillhole EC023 intersected 2.2m grading 0.9% copper, 0.2% lead, 0.1% zinc, 56.00 g/t silver and 1.84 g/t gold

  • Sulphide mineralization at El Cura continues to extend to the west

Two other holes that were drilled, EC016 and EC017, returned no significant results and appear to have traversed the target below the plunge projection of the mineralization (Figure 3). Significant results are tabulated in Table 1.
